10-05-2022 03:05 PM
Check the white wire is firmly in the Nest terminal as that is W1 heat control wire that turns on your heat when the Nest sends out + 24 volts on the white wire to the control board.
Also check the W1 screw is tight on the white wire on the control board and no wires are touching each other making a short circuit.
You must have 2 stage heating and they used the OB wire and it goes to W2 (2nd stage heating) on control board.
